Loletta Dell McCombs was born on September 14, 1949, in Akron, Ohio to the late Ralph, Sr. and Elizabeth McCombs. God so graciously transitioned Loletta from her earthly body to forever be with Him in Paradise on February 24, 2022.  Loletta retired from the Oriana House.
